PR25 1XL is a mixed residential area on Leyland Lane, 0.5km from Straits in Leyland. Administratively it sits within Earnshaw Bridge ward and the South Ribble constituency.

For families considering a move, PR25 1XL represents a terrace-heavy neighbourhood — tight-knit community, affordable housing. Outside of residential hours, mainly white, agricultural workforce, on the edges of smaller towns. The 47 average age signals a mature family neighbourhood — long-term residents, good local schools, and high levels of owner-occupation. 80% of properties are owner-occupied — a strong indicator of neighbourhood stability and long-term community investment.

Safety: Crime is moderate at 56 incidents per 1,000 residents — broadly typical for this type of urban area. Property: With prices averaging £170k, this is one of the more affordable postcodes in the area, up 34.5% year-on-year.

Census 2021 statistics for PR25 1XL are sourced from Output Area E00129207 (shared with 10 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
